What is the purpose of this form?

The Employee's Withholding Allowance Certificate is designed to inform employers of the amount to withhold from an employee's wages for state taxes. It allows employees to claim allowances and ensures that the correct amount of tax is withheld from their paychecks. Proper completion of this form helps prevent under-withholding or over-withholding of state income taxes.

What happens if I fail to submit this form?

Failing to submit the Employee's Withholding Allowance Certificate can result in higher withholding than necessary. The employer will default to withholding as if you were a single filer with zero allowances, leading to increased tax payments. This could affect your take-home pay and overall financial planning.

How do I know when to use this form?

This form should be used whenever an employee needs to adjust their state tax withholding based on changes in life circumstances, such as marriage, changes in dependents, or adjustments in income. It is essential to update your form when starting a new job or if your financial situation changes significantly. Using the form correctly ensures appropriate tax withholding from your paycheck.

Frequently Asked Question

Can I use a previous year's form?

No, you must use the current form for the current tax year.

How often do I need to submit this form?

You should submit a new form whenever your withholding situation changes.

What if my income significantly changes?

You should complete a new NC-4EZ to reflect your current withholding preferences.

Is there a deadline for submitting this form?

It should be submitted as soon as possible to ensure accurate withholding.

Can I claim additional allowances?

Yes, based on your tax situation, you may claim additional allowances.

What if I make a mistake on the form?

You can correct errors by submitting a new form.

Can both spouses file jointly using one form?

Each spouse must submit their form to accurately reflect their withholdings.

Do I need to provide proof of deductions?

You do not need to provide proof when submitting the form, but keep documentation for your records.

What happens if I forget to submit it?

Your employer will withhold at the highest rate if you fail to submit the form.

Can I update my form online?

Yes, if your employer allows, you can update it online through their payroll system.
